Bellingham Station is equipped to facilitate easy ticket purchases with its ticket office open from Monday to Friday between 06:10 and 19:30, and on weekends with reduced hours. You’ll find ticket machines that also accommodate those travelers with a Disabled Persons Railcard. There's a seamless provision for collecting tickets bought online, ensuring that your travel plans remain uninterrupted. Expect to find all crucial customer information displayed on screens accompanied by regular announcements.
While Bellingham does well in terms of its ticketing services, the station sacrifices some amenities in other areas. It lacks step-free access, which may pose challenges for those with mobility issues—though assistance can be readily arranged through staffed help points. Security measures include CCTV coverage, providing peace of mind for those using the bicycle storage facilities or waiting for trains.
For rail travelers excited to explore beyond the station confines, Bellingham connects efficiently with other travel modes. Despite the absence of accessible taxis and car park provisions, plenty of local bus services are accessible from the station vicinity. A detailed 'Onward Travel Information Map' is available on-site to aid in planning the next leg of your journey. During disturbances or planned works, detailed information regarding rail replacement services is also accessible.

The station might not have a traditional ticket office, but it compensates with ticket machines that are both accessible and user-friendly. These allow passengers to collect tickets purchased online with ease, ensuring a smooth and stress-free start to your journey. While smartcards aren't issued here, validators are in place to accommodate commuters using this system.
For those in need of assistance or information, there are help points available. While no staff assistance is present, the station ensures that important travel information is readily available through screens and announcements. Although there are no formal waiting rooms, shelters on each platform provide a comfortable spot to sit as you wait for your train.
Accessibility is a hallmark of Portway Park & Ride, featuring step-free access throughout the station. This level A station offers ramps for train access, ensuring that every traveler can move freely around the premises. The station's commitment to safety is unwavering, with CCTV coverage enhancing the feeling of security for all passengers.

One of the unique aspects of the Portway Park & Ride station is the availability of a rail replacement bus service, with bus stops conveniently located on Portway. Although there is no parking directly at the station itself, facilities are managed by the Bristol City Council around the area, proving practical for day-trippers and regular commuters who might opt to park off-site.
As for comforts like refreshments or shopping, travelers will have to plan accordingly as these services are not available on site. However, the station provides essential amenities such as free Wi-Fi, which is easy to connect to and ensures travelers can stay updated while on the move.
